The purpose of the KBS Online website is to provide information of current interest, a calendar to assist all village organisations with their forward planning, and a discussion forum by means of a bulletin board facility. The website is provided primarily for the inhabitants of Kingston Bagpuize, Southmoor, Longworth and surrounding villages, but also for former residents, intending visitors and others interested in the area. 2. Website policy and content shall be controlled by a Website Management Group (WMG). 3. The Officers of the WMG shall comprise the Chairman, Secretary, and Treasurer. 4. The WMG shall comprise the Officers, the Webmaster(s), a representative of the KBS News committee nominated by that committee (to ensure close liaison between these two main channels of communication in the village), and up to two other members. 5. The Webmaster role shall preferably be held jointly by two individuals, but where this is not possible, a Webmaster and a Deputy Webmaster shall be appointed by the Managing Committee on a renewable annual basis. (The dual appointment is necessary in order to ensure continuity in the absence of the Webmaster). 6. The WMG will be responsible for the moderation of contributions to the Bulletin Board to ensure that no offensive material is published. 7. The WMG may at its discretion allow authorised officers of the various local organisations to post their own events on the calendar, but overall responsibility for the calendar facility remains with the WMG. 8. The KBSOnline website shall include information provided by the Kingston Bagpuize with Southmoor Parish Council in compliance with the council’s current publication policy. 9. The financial year shall run from 1 April, and an Annual General Meeting, open to all residents of Kingston Bagpuize with Southmoor, will be held in October each year. 10. All members of the WMG with the exception of the KBS News nominee shall be elected at the Annual General Meeting and shall serve for 12 months. The WMG may fill any casual vacancy by co-option until the next AGM. 11. The KBS News nominee shall also be elected annually to serve for 1 year, but this election will take place at the KBS News AGM. 12. The WMG shall meet at least twice in the year. Four members will form a quorum. 13. A bank account will be maintained in the name of KBS Online, under the control of the Treasurer. Withdrawals may be made on the signatures of any two of the Chairman, Secretary and Treasurer. 14. The Treasurer shall present to the AGM a statement of accounts approved by an independent external examiner for the year ended 31 March immediately preceding the AGM. 15. Special General Meetings (SGM) may be called by the Chairman, and must be called by him at the written request of ten or more residents of Kingston Bagpuize with Southmoor. Such a meeting must be held within eight weeks of the request, and will be open to all residents of the village. The agenda and any motions to be submitted shall be publicised prominently on the website for at least two weeks prior to the SGM. 16. This Constitution may only be altered at an AGM or SGM. Any alteration will be adopted only if supported by at least two-thirds of those present at the meeting. With the exception of amendments proposed by the WMG, notice of any proposed alteration must be given to the Secretary in writing, proposed and seconded, at least six weeks before the meeting. All proposed amendments will be published on the website as detailed in 15 above. 17. In the event of the winding up of KBS Online, any residual assets will be donated to one or more local good causes. 1st Draft 27 March 2003 revision 1 30 May 2003 revision 2 26 June 2003 |
